Former Nissan CEO arrested again

Japan’s prosecutors have re-arrested cases of Nissan CEO Carlos Ghosn today. According to local media, Ghosn has been arrested for violating trust, with aggravating circumstances.

A Japanese judge yesterday rejected a request from the prosecutors to extend the pre-trial order of Ghosn. This cleared the way that he would be released on bail today.

Under the new charge Ghosn could be detained for up to 10 days according to local media. The Frenchman has been stuck on suspicion of tax fraud as CEO of Nissan since mid-November.
